Hi experts
Is there a minimum wage requirement for CEC? According to my duties, I fall under NOC 2121, however, on job bank it says minimum wage for that NOC to be 28$ but I am paid 22$. Can that affect my CEC application?
Please consider that I do not need LMIA for my job as I am working on PGWP. I do not have or I am not claiming any points for arranged employment.
Thanks
No effect on your application.
No effect on your application.

Another question, Do I need to submit pay stubs of each month or just T4 and NOA is fine? Please suggest!
Secondly, If i do need pay stub, does it need to have information like hours? I am a semi salaried employee and It does not mention a number of hours. Though I plan to support that using a reference letter about my number of hours.
Thanks!
Pay stubs aren't mandatory but if you have them i'd suggest to submit a few of them.
I only submitted my 3 most recent pay stubs and didn't have any issues.
